Yousaf wrote:
> Just bought a new Dell Inspiron 530 which came with a 32 bit Vista
> Basic. I want to remove this and clean install Win XP 64 as my main
> home desktop. Due to fact I work from home, it is imperative that
> Win XP 64 works like a production system.
>
> So far, I have read negative reviews about XP 64 bit. Mostly people
> mention driver issues. I just wanted to know if that is still the
> case. Is there anyone out there who has a similar system and has
> been using XP 64 bit? If so please reply to this post and let me
> know how you got on.
It all depends on what you run (software), what hardware you have connected
and if 64-bit drivers are available for all the hardware you will be using,
etc.
Since you have pointed none of that out except that you have an Inspiron 530
(which does not seem to have Dell Drivers available to run Windows XP x64 :
http://support.dell.com/support/downloads/driverslist.aspx?c=us&cs=19&l=en&s=dhs&ServiceTag=&SystemID=INSP_DSKTP_D530&os=WLH&osl=en&catid=&impid -
so it may not even be possible to do what you are trying to do) - there's
not much anyone culd do to tell you if what you want to do would work
(beyond what I have.)
